Output ef2676b8222d36012897e11242f32d32522918678552e4371c9ca76296a8862f:3

value
102040
script pubkey
OP_0 OP_PUSHBYTES_20 aa3c221323918c20bef998c4c5aef9b6ed00d58e
address
bc1q4g7zyyerjxxzp0henrzvtthekmksp4vw8sk6q2
transaction
ef2676b8222d36012897e11242f32d32522918678552e4371c9ca76296a8862f